Sold two bikes today...

So I sold two bikes today that I had absolutely no intention of selling if you had asked me last week. One was my beloved '89 Schwinn Prelude and the other an old Univega our shop had used as an errand bike before they closed down last year. My garage is getting a little too full, and I wanted to get the funds together for a C&V ride I had my eyes on. Both bikes were listed on Friday, and I was in touch with the first buyer (Schwinn) on Saturday. We met today, and as much as I hated seeing that bike go, I found out he planned on commuting to work on it (only a couple of miles) and riding it around. So I felt pretty good in the end.

The Univega blew up on CL late last night and this morning, with 4 or 5 people asking about it. College just started back up (and I live in a college town) so I figured the person I did eventually sell to would be a student. Turns out she went to school here, moved back to NYC and just moved back here not very long ago. Has no car of her own and wanted a bicycle to get around. Again, I felt really good in the end selling that one to another person who planned on using a bike for transportation. I started telling her about the Co-op here and other resources (she was a little unsure of herself but seemed to really want to just get around by bike), so we decided to stay in touch.

All in all, a day I wasn't necessarily happy about turned into a day of feeling good that some good bikes went to good people who plan on using them a lot and taking care of them. And now I can afford the Raleigh.
